Longan, Goji, Ginger and Roasted Brown Rice Tea

Why people make this tea

This one is pure childhood nostalgia for Nourilo. Around Lunar New Year his parents would brew a big pot of red-date water for guests, sometimes adding longan and goji — sweet, comforting, and good for you. Since early spring still carries a chill, this version adds toasted brown rice and ginger to warm the stomach and chase the cold away.

Method

  1. Put all the ingredients in a teapot. Rinse once with boiling water, then pour fresh boiling water over them.
  2. Cover and steep for 15 minutes, then drink.

Nourilo’s Tips

To make the roasted brown rice: use three-colour, red or yellow brown rice (no need to wash), dry-toast it in a pan for about 7 minutes, then store in a glass jar and take a spoonful whenever you need it. This tea warms the stomach, dispels cold and supports the complexion. Pregnant women should not use longan — substitute red or black dates.
